The bedrock of quantum computer technology rests on cutting-edge quantum hardware systems . that constitute a profound breakaway from traditional computer designs. These systems operate on principles that leverage the bizarre attributes of quantum physics, embracing superposition and unity, to process intelligence in methods that classic computing machines like the ASUS ProArt just cannot duplicate. Modern quantum processors require stringent environmental settings, commonly operating at heat levels nearing absolute nothingness to preserve the sensitive quantum states vital for computing. The engineering challenges involved in developing stable quantum hardware systems are enormous, necessitating meticulous manufacturing techniques and cutting-edge materials science. Companies worldwide are injecting billions into building increasingly robust and scalable quantum processors, with each generation offering improved coordination times and diminished error ratios.

The real-world quantum entanglement applications cover many fields and carry on expand as our insight deepens. Quantum entanglement, typically called 'spooky activity at a distance,' allows associations among particles that stay connected in spite of the physical distance separating them. This phenomenon constitutes the backbone of quantum cryptography systems that ensure irrefutable protection for secret exchanges. In quantum detection applications, entangled quanta can attain appraisal exactness that exceeds conventional barriers, enabling progress in fields like gravitational wave detection and magnetic field sensing. Quantum entanglement applications also play a key role in quantum teleportation protocols, which allow the transfer of quantum data across distances without tangibly moving the units themselves. Research bodies are exploring ways in which entanglement can enhance quantum radar systems and enhance the precision of atomic clocks utilized in worldwide positioning systems. The progression of quantum software development methodologies has turned into crucial as quantum computer technology shifts from theoretical study to practical applications. Unlike traditional coding, quantum software development necessitates intrinsically different methodologies to formula development and execution, harnessing quantum phenomena to acquire computational benefits. Developers should take into account quantum-specific tenets such as quantum circuits, circuit depth, and decoherence when crafting approaches for quantum chips. The quantum software development ecosystem includes state-of-the-art simulators that enable scientists to evaluate and refine their algorithms before deploying them on real quantum hardware.
